This page goes through the geometry steps for the 3D Bifurcating Artery - Exercises in the SpaceClaim geometry engine included with ANSYS Workbench. For instructions on creating the geometry using SolidWorks see the page 3D Bifurcating Artery - Exercises (Legacy). |

Create a new sketch, move to one end of the obstruction
Use Spline to mimic the artery boundary (just click on the edge of the artery that is visible and follow the dots that show up)
Use Offset Curve to create two more curves: one inside and one outside the artery
Return to 3D mode
Hide the artery
Delete the inner portions of the resulting surfaces leaving only the outer ring
Unhide the artery
Do the same on the other end of the obstruction
Hide the artery
Use Blend and then control + click the two faces that remain
Unhide the artery
Ctrl + Click the missing ellipse and fillet and click Fill if you haven’t already
Use Combine as before to create three solids
Delete or suppress all entities except the artery
Use pull to smooth any sharp edges as desired
